About the Role

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Investment Analyst to join our team at LBS Properties. As a key member of our finance department, you will work closely with the Head of Acquisitions and Finance Director to provide financial analysis on new acquisitions, assist with investor and lender presentations, conduct market analysis, and support the financial management of live investments and developments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Investment/Development Acquisitions
    • Conduct due diligence for new acquisitions, including financial modelling and business plan preparation.
    • Prepare presentation materials for investors, lenders, and senior management.
    • Perform detailed market analysis, including comparables, pipeline assessments, and sales trends.
    • Collaborate with the transaction execution team throughout acquisition processes.
  • Market/Data Analysis
    • Lead ongoing data analysis of sectors, markets, and submarkets to identify trends that support investment and acquisition decisions.
    • Monitor and report on emerging trends in the real estate market.
  • Project Accounting and Financial Management
    • Assist the Finance Director with financial reporting across all development projects and investment assets.
    • Prepare project budgets, cash flow models, and other financial reporting documents.
    • Aid in the preparation of monthly reports to investors and lenders for each project.
    • Work with third-party providers on the financial management of investment properties, including budgeting, invoicing, and arrears reporting.
Requirements
  • Education: Recent graduate (undergraduate or postgraduate) with a strong interest in the real estate sector.
  • Experience: Previous internship or work experience in real estate, finance, or a related field is beneficial.
  • Technical Skills: Proficient in Excel, PowerPoint, and Word, with experience in financial modelling.
  • Personal Attributes: Highly motivated, detail-oriented, and capable of delivering high-quality work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Other Skills: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, and strong organizational abilities.
